Wikileaks: Merkel's Greek debt talks

The interceptions of the US National Security Agency at Merkel and German officials of great Greek interest reveal Wikileakswww.wikileaks.org) in exclusive cooperation with the Nation for Greece.merkel 1 Merkel Merkel

From secret documents that the newspaper had accessed in the last week and managed to elaborate and analyze in depth, it appears that the German Chancellor Merkel has not believed for years that a brave cut of Greek debt would be a real solution to the "Greek problem".

The classified NSA document notes that she appeared to feel "at a loss" about which -another haircut or immediate assistance- would be better to deal with the situation and that "her fear was that Athens would be unable to overcome the problem even with an additional 'haircut', since she could not to manage the rest of her debt." It is also reported that he was considering lobbying the US and UK to impose a special tax on financial transactions to help bank liquidity.

It also reveals that Wolfgang Schäuble, Finance Minister Wolfgang Schäuble, was the only one in the German cabinet in favor of the additional cut, "despite Merkel's attempts to" curb "him.

On the other hand, France and European Commission President Manuel Barroso, as mentioned in the secret document, were in favor of a more gentle approach. "The president of the European Central Bank, Jean-Claude Trichet, was firmly opposed, and Christine Lagarde, the general manager of the International Monetary Fund, was described as" undecided ", NSA officials said.

This particular confidential report has been made on the basis of the information undermined by EU Chief Executive Officer of German Chancellery Nikolaus Meyer-Landrut, who gave 14 October 2011 an overview of what Berlin is planning to ask for and ready to support in view of the summits that followed the main issue of the Greek issue. It is impressive that a proposal for a BRICS (Brazil, Russia, India, China and South Africa) contribution was planned at the time for the rescue of Greece.

The document states: “Berlin would not agree to give the European Financial Stability Facility (EFSF) a banking licence. It would also not accept the establishment of a joint Special Purpose Vehicle between the EFSF and the European Central Bank, or any other measure that would require legislative changes by member states. On the other hand, the Germans will support the of a special program of the International Monetary Fund in which the BRICS countries (Brazil, Russia, India, China and South Africa) will "throw" funds for the purpose of strengthening rescue activities in the eurozone".
